Latest Patents

Laliberte holds a patent for "Cytidine deaminase cDNA as a positive selectable marker for gene." This invention involves a DNA sequence for the human cytidine deaminase that has been engineered into an eukaryotic expression vector. This advancement allows for the expression of cytidine deaminase in mammalian cells, which confers resistance to cytosine nucleoside analogs, such as cytosine arabinoside. The expression of cytidine deaminase protects cells from the toxic effects of these analogs, providing potential applications in gene therapy for malignant, immune, and viral diseases. Additionally, a bacterial expression vector containing the gene can be utilized to produce cytidine deaminase in large quantities.
